Abstract (EN)
Malign melanom is the most fatal skin tumour with an increasing incidence. The unresponsiveness to chemotherapy and radiotherapy and rapid resistance to BRAF inhibitors are the main treatment difficulties. Mutations in the MAPK pathway are the main factor in carcinogenesis in melanoma, and the inhibition of resistance to MAPK inhibitors is principal for treatment. Hypoxia defines the low oxygen level in tumour microenviroment. Reactive oxygen species effects the HIF-1α gene and HIF-1α target mechanisms. Hypoxic conditions activates different pathways such as apoptosis and proliferation. The effect of hypoxia on resistance to BRAF inhibitors is still unknown. The determination of resistance mechanisms and definion of possible target molecules will prevent therapy failure and obtain longer survival rates and curability.
